Heard in the Branch Appellate Court at ' the March term, 1914.\nAffirmed.\nOpinion filed April 22, 1915.\nStatement of the Case.\nAction by Thomas Chvatal and Barbara Chvatal against Lev (Lion) Homestead Association, a corporation, to recover the withdrawal value of stock of said Association owned by the plaintiffs. The Association claimed that a voucher for the amount due was issued to them and that they indorsed it over to the treasurer as a personal loan to him, which the plaintiffs denied. After the voucher was drawn the treasurer disappeared. From a judgment for two hundred dollars, defendant brings error.\nAbstract of the Decision.\n1. Building and loan associations, \u00a7 36 \u2014when recovery of withdrawal value sustained. An action against a building and loan association to recover the withdrawal value of stock, defendant averred payment by means of a voucher issued to plaintiffs, who had indorsed it to defendant\u2019s treasurer as a personal loan, who in the meantime had disappeared, the evidence was held insufficient to sustain the defendant\u2019s claim, the voucher having been lost, and there being no testimony as to the genuineness of the indorsement.\n2. Appeal and bbbob, \u00a7 479*\u2014when objection necessary to instruction. Where the record shows that no objections of any kind were made to any part of the instructions, complaint cannot be made that the court erred in its oral instructions.\nQ. J.
